Network Engineer Salary in Los Angeles, California
The median network engineer salary in Los Angeles, CA is $148,120 per year, which is 61.0% above the national median and 5.2% above the California state average.
Network Engineer Salary in Los Angeles by Experience
In Los Angeles, an entry-level network engineer earns around $96,600, while experienced professionals earn up to $222,180 per year. The local cost of living index is 146% of the national average.
Salary Percentiles in Los Angeles, CA
| Percentile | Los Angeles |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ile | $90,160 |
| 25th Percentile | $119,140 |
| Median (50th) | $148,120 |
| 75th Percentile | $189,980 |
| 90th Percentile | $233,450 |
